Bill Summary
Relative to the licensure of swimming pool builders and service contractors
AI Summary
This bill aims to establish a licensure system for swimming pool builders and service contractors in Massachusetts. It defines key terms such as the "International Swimming Pool and Spa Code (ISPSC)," "license," "swimming pool," "swimming pool builder," and "swimming pool maintenance, service and repair technician." The bill requires individuals engaged in swimming pool construction, installation, maintenance, service, and repair work to obtain a license from the Massachusetts Board of Building Regulations and Standards by meeting certain experience, training, and examination requirements. It also outlines penalties for engaging in such work without a proper license. The bill provides a grace period for individuals actively working in the industry prior to the implementation of the new licensing requirements.
